U.S. Army Corps of Engineers, Louisville District intends to award Firm Fixed Price Task Order restricting competition to a specific brand-name item. This is a written notice to inform the public of the Government's intent to award on a sole source basis pursuant to Federal Acquisition Regulation FAR 8.405-6(b). This requirement is for Furniture, Fixtures and Equipment required to support the NA1809 Temporary Living Support Facility, Commander Fleet Activities Yokosuka, Japan for the Unites States Navy. The Government will purchase the FF&E directly through competitive solicitation utilizing the General Services Administration (GSA) Schedule Contract through the GSA eBuy platform and the award of a GSA delivery order contract. The project specifications include six (27) instances where a name-brand product description is used to describe the project’s FF&E requirements, including commercial kitchen equipment. Attachment 1 includes a complete list of items described with a brand name or equal product description, and their estimated costs. (See attached spreadsheet for a list of all required brand name items) THIS REQUIREMENT IS OCONUS. THIS NOTICE OF INTENT IS NOT A REQUEST FOR COMPETITIVE QUOTES. Interested firms may submit information that indicates their ability to satisfy this requirement. All responsible sources may submit a response which if timely received, will be considered by the Agency. The North American Industry Classification System (NAICS) for this requirement is 337214. Any capability statements, proposals, or quotations must be submitted to Alyson Klinglesmith via email at alyson.m.klinglesmith@usace.army.mil no later than 04:00 PM Eastern Time (ET), 19 August 2026. A determination by the Government not to compete the proposed acquisition based upon responses to this notice is solely within the discretion of the Government. Information received will be considered solely for the purpose of determining whether to conduct a competitive requirement.
